Nicor Gas Rebates Overview

Nicor Gas offers rebates to commercial, public, multi-family (3 units or more), and agricultural customers who install qualifying high-efficiency natural gas equipment between January 1 and December 31, 2025. Rebates are available for products such as boilers, furnaces, infrared heaters, unit heaters, steam traps, and commercial kitchen equipment. Rebates typically range from $25 to over $1,500 per system depending on type and capacity. Applications must be submitted within 90 days of installation or by January 31, 2026, whichever comes first.

High-Efficiency Heating and Boiler Rebates

For commercial and multi-family buildings, Nicor Gas offers substantial incentives for installing efficient space and water heating systems. Condensing boilers earn $1.50 per MBTUH, while non-condensing boilers qualify for $1.25 per MBTUH, up to a maximum of $1,500 per unit. Boilers must meet minimum efficiency thresholds of 90% TE for condensing and 85% TE for non-condensing systems. Add-on boiler reset controls can earn $1.25 per MBTUH as long as they automatically adjust water temperature based on outdoor air conditions.

Other heating-related incentives include:

  • Infrared heaters: $700 per unit when replacing older gas-fired heaters.
  • Condensing unit heaters: $325 per unit for thermal efficiency ≥ 90%.
  • Direct-fired space heaters: Up to $750 depending on capacity and efficiency.

For facilities with multiple heating systems, such as warehouses, schools, or manufacturing spaces, these Nicor business energy rebates can significantly reduce upfront costs while improving operational efficiency.

Boiler Tune-Up Rebates

Routine boiler maintenance plays a vital role in efficiency and safety. Nicor Gas offers $0.30 per MBTUH (up to $500 per boiler) for qualified boiler tune-ups completed by a professional contractor. The service must include pre- and post-tune-up combustion testing and demonstrate an increase in efficiency. Tune-ups are eligible every three years for space-heating boilers and every two years for process boilers. This rebate ensures that heating systems run at peak performance while cutting unnecessary fuel waste.

Steam Trap Rebates

Steam systems are common in industrial and institutional settings, and failed steam traps can cause major energy losses. Nicor Gas provides $200 per trap for replacements or repairs with a qualifying third-party survey for commercial, industrial, or dry cleaner steam traps. Without a survey, the rebate drops to $25 per trap. Surveys must verify that traps leak or blow through. Facilities such as hospitals, universities, and dry cleaners can benefit most, as steam trap maintenance translates directly to lower operating costs and improved system reliability.

Rebates for Commercial Food Service Equipment

Restaurants, cafeterias, and institutional kitchens can take advantage of Nicor Gas rebates on ENERGY STAR certified natural gas cooking appliances. Examples include:

  • Conveyor ovens: Up to $1,000 per deck.
  • Combination ovens: $900 per deck.
  • Convection ovens and fryers: $150–$400 per unit.
  • Steamers and rotisserie ovens: $500–$950 depending on model.

These rebates help food service businesses offset the cost of upgrading to energy-efficient, faster-cooking equipment that reduces gas consumption and heat loss. Installing low-flow pre-rinse spray valves can also earn $25 each, saving both water and energy.

Nicor Gas Agriculture Incentives

Agricultural customers are eligible for specialized Nicor Gas agriculture incentives designed to improve energy efficiency in dairies, greenhouses, and grain operations. Key rebates include:

  • Dairy water heaters: $50–$100 for ENERGY STAR units depending on capacity and efficiency.
  • Grain dryer tune-ups: $0.50 per MBTUH, capped at $500 per dryer.
  • Greenhouse boiler tune-ups: $0.50 per MBTUH up to $1,500 per boiler.
  • Greenhouse boiler O₂ trim controls: $0.35 per MBTUH, capped at $800.
  • Greenhouse linkageless boiler controls: $150 per boiler.

Greenhouses can further benefit from rebates on infrared film and thermal curtain installations, which help retain heat and reduce fuel consumption during colder months. These measures are designed to boost operational savings while maintaining optimal growing conditions.
